PuppyGit是一款专为安卓设备设计的开源Git版本控制客户端,采用无广告的免费模式提供给开发者使用。该软件实现了在移动端对代码仓库的完整管理功能,用户可通过手机直接进行代码同步、版本控制等操作。特别针对笔记类应用优化,支持与Obsidian等主流笔记软件的深度集成,实现笔记内容的版本管理和多设备同步。
1、首先下载安装软件,打开后需要设置Git账号信息
2、点击左上角菜单图标进入功能选择界面
3、添加代码仓库,用于保存和管理项目文件
4、在文件管理页可以浏览所有文件,支持导入项目或复制文件路径
5、使用内置编辑器修改各类文件内容,支持多种文件格式
6、在服务管理页按需启用所需功能
7、通过自动化设置实现代码仓库的自动同步更新
1、PuppyGit是安卓手机上免费的Git管理工具,干净无广告
2、不仅能同步程序代码,还能管理Obsidian等笔记软件的文档仓库
3、支持通过Tasker自动化工具调用Git操作
4、首次连接陌生服务器时会主动询问是否允许,保障使用安全
5、也可以在设置里改为默认允许所有主机连接
1、操作简单:界面友好直观,新手也能快速学会使用
2、图形化管理:所有Git操作都能通过点击完成,不用记复杂命令
3、多系统支持:Windows、Mac、Linux电脑都能用
4、避免失误:减少手动输入,降低出错概率
5、历史记录可视化:清晰展示代码修改记录和分支关系,管理更方便
1、问:为什么我的 github 密码不起作用!?
答:如果您启用了2fa,则必须创建个人访问令牌而不是密码,或者您可以使用ssh而不是https。
2、问:如何提交所有更改?
答:有两种方法:
方法 1:您可以点击顶部栏的三个点图标,然后点击"全部提交"
方法2:长按更改列表项以启用ChangeList的选择模式(顺便说一句:点击项目图标也可以启用它),然后您可以选择全部并提交/推送/阶段/恢复/等
3、问:如何恢复已删除的文件?
答:只有当git跟踪了某个文件并创建了包含它的提交后,您才可以恢复该文件:
方法1.您可以找到包含该文件的提交,然后将其差异到本地,然后按文件名过滤更改列表,然后就可以恢复它了。
方法2:您可以在文件视图中创建一个具有相同名称的相同路径的文件,然后单击3个点图标,您将看到"文件历史记录",单击它,您将看到该1文件的所有版本,然后您可以选择一个版本进行还原
4、问:我为编辑器和Diff启用了快照功能,如何找到快照文件?
答:转到路径PuppyGit-Data/FileSnapshot,然后您可以按名称过滤文件,并且文件名包含时间戳,指示文件创建的时间